Rising price of pet wellness care is an ongoing challenge for pet house owners
The Animal Rescue League of Boston (ARL) is searching for a loving household to absorb a nine-year-old mixed-breed canine just lately surrendered as a consequence of medical prices.
The sort of give up is turning into extra commonplace, as based on a latest report compiled by PetSmart Charities and Gallup, seven out of 10 pet house owners have forgone veterinary care as a consequence of monetary constraints, a transparent signal that pet house owners throughout the nation are scuffling with the growing prices of care.
Pebbles was surrendered to ARL this previous week, and her thorough veterinary examination revealed gastrointestinal irritation, an ear an infection, pores and skin an infection and irritation as a consequence of allergic reactions, and since she’s an older canine, arthritis was additionally identified in her knees and hips.
The gastrointestinal, and continual ear and pores and skin points have been handled and resolved, and Pebbles is now prepared to search out her new residence.
ARL goals to maintain folks and pets collectively and gives a large number of community-based, low-cost pet wellness providers, nonetheless, animals like Pebbles which have continual situations that require treatment and extra frequent journeys to the vet generally is a pricey, and the group understands that the price of this ongoing care can turn into overwhelming.
In these cases, give up is usually the most suitable choice for each the animal and folks concerned, and ARL encourages anybody going through a lot of these struggles to succeed in out to its Animal Care & Adoption Facilities, positioned in Boston, Dedham, and Brewster.
